WebOct 12, 2024 · On Sept. 25, 2008, the FDIC took over the bank and sold it to JPMorgan Chase for $1.9 billion. 11 The next day, Washington Mutual Inc., the bank's holding company, declared bankruptcy. 12 It was the second-largest bankruptcy in history, after Lehman Brothers. 13. On the surface, it seems that JPMorgan Chase got a good deal. WebNov 22, 2010 · SIPC is a non-profit organization created in 1970 under the Securities Investor Protection Act (SIPA) that provides limited coverage to investors on their brokerage accounts if their brokerage firm becomes insolvent. All brokerage firms that do business with the investing public are required to be members of SIPC. SIPC protection is limited.
